LinkNYC Kiosks
LinkNYC kiosks are a great resource for charging your phone in Union Square. These kiosks offer free charging stations, as well as free Wi-Fi, phone calls, and access to a range of city services. With several LinkNYC kiosks located throughout Union Square, you’re never far from a convenient charging station.

How can I find charging stations in Union Square?
To find charging stations in Union Square, visitors can use online directories or mobile apps that provide real-time information on charging station locations and availability. These platforms often allow users to filter search results by location, charging type, and network provider. Additionally, many charging station operators offer their own apps and websites, making it easy for users to find and navigate to their charging points. Visitors can also look for signage and maps throughout the area, which indicate the location of nearby charging stations.
Some popular online directories and apps for finding charging stations in Union Square include PlugShare, ChargeHub, and Google Maps. These platforms provide up-to-date information on charging station locations, hours of operation, and pricing. By using these resources, visitors can quickly and easily find a convenient charging station to meet their needs.
